Comprehending the Italian Regulatory Landscape
Before looking for weight reduction pills, it is vital to comprehend how Italy manages these items. The Italian Ministry of Health (Ministero della Salute) and the European Medicines Agency (EMA) strictly monitor weight management items to secure customer security.
Typically, weight-loss items in Italy fall into 3 classifications:
- Prescription Medications: Drugs developed for significant weight loss or weight problems treatment (e.g., specific GLP-1 receptor agonists or lipase inhibitors). These require a prescription from a licensed Italian physician.
- Over-the-Counter (OTC) Pharmacy Products: Pharmacist-recommended help, such as medical gadgets for fat binding or carbohydrate blocking, which can be acquired without a prescription.
- Food Supplements (Integratori Erboristici Per La Perdita Di Peso In Italia Alimentari): Natural components, vitamins, organic extracts, and metabolic process boosters. These are extensively available in grocery stores, herbalist stores, and online, but they can not lawfully make medical claims about treating weight problems.
Where to Buy Weight Loss Pills in Italy: The Main Options
Consumers have several reliable avenues for purchasing weight management items across the nation, each with its own advantages.
1. Traditional Brick-and-Mortar Pharmacies (Farmacie)
The most trusted and managed place to purchase health-related items in Italy is the regional farmacia. Easily identified by a radiant green cross, Italian pharmacies utilize licensed pharmacists who can offer expert medical suggestions.
- What you can discover: Prescription weight-loss drugs, medical-grade OTC supplements, and top quality organic formulas.
- Pros: Expert assistance, ensured item credibility, and safety screening for possible drug interactions.
- Cons: Prices can be higher than online alternatives, and a consultation might be needed for specific items.
2. Para-pharmacies (Parafarmacie)
Parafarmacie are comparable to traditional pharmacies, but they normally do not offer prescription-only medications. Instead, they concentrate on OTC drugs, cosmetics, child products, and dietary supplements.
- What you can find: A variety of Integratori Erboristici Per La Perdita Di Peso In Italia alimentari, fat burners, appetite suppressants, and meal replacement shakes.
- Pros: Often less congested than traditional pharmacies, well-informed personnel concerning supplements, and competitive pricing.
- Cons: Can not give prescription-only weight loss medications.
3. Herbalist Shops (Erboristerie)
For those looking for natural, plant-based weight loss support, Italian erboristerie are popular destinations. Italy has an abundant custom of natural medication (fitoterapia).
- What you can find: Herbal teas, green tea extracts, Garcinia Cambogia, glucomannan, and exclusive botanical blends created to support metabolism and food digestion.
- Pros: Highly specialized personnel concerning natural treatments; products lean greatly toward organic and natural active ingredients.
- Cons: Lack of regulation compared to pharmaceuticals; efficacy differs widely depending upon clinical backing.
4. Supermarkets and Hypermarkets (Supermercati e Ipermercati)
Major Italian grocery store chains (such as Esselunga, Coop, Conad, and Carrefour) usually include a devoted health and wellness aisle.
- What you can discover: Basic dietary supplements, herbal teas, protein powders, and meal replacement bars.
- Pros: Highly hassle-free during regular grocery shopping; typically the most budget-friendly choice.
- Cons: Limited choice; items are generally mild maintenance help rather than powerful weight reduction services.
5. Online Retailers and E-commerce
E-commerce has actually grown exponentially in Italy, offering access to both domestic and international weight reduction products.
- What you can find: Everything from worldwide acknowledged brands to regional Italian supplements.
- Pros: Home shipment, easy price contrast, and discreet product packaging.
- Cons: High risk of counterfeit products on uncontrolled third-party platforms; shipping hold-ups from outside the EU relating to custom-mades assessments.

When browsing Italian shops or online platforms, consumers generally experience a few primary classifications of weight-loss help:
- Fiber-Based Supplements (e.g., Glucomannan): Expands in the stomach to promote a sensation of fullness. Commonly discovered in farmacie and erboristerie.
- Thermogenic Fat Burners: Often contain caffeine, guarana, or bitter orange (arancio amaro). Developed to temporarily improve metabolism and energy levels.
- Carbohydrate and Fat Blockers: Medical devices developed to bind to dietary fats or block carbohydrate absorption in the gastrointestinal tract.
- Botanical Extracts: Artichoke (carciofo) and dandelion (tarassaco) extracts, greatly preferred in Italy for liver assistance and detoxification as part of weight management programs.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)1. Can I purchase prescription weight loss pills in Italy without a doctor's check out?
No. Prescription medications, such as strong cravings suppressants or medical weight problems treatments, strictly require a valid prescription (Acquistare Antidolorifici Senza Ricetta In Italia medica) provided by an Italian or recognized European physician.
2. Are Amazon Italy and local online pharmacies safe for buying supplements?
Yes, purchasing from regulated Italian online pharmacies (which display the main EU security logo for online medicine sales) is completely safe. However, care ought to be exercised when purchasing from third-party sellers on worldwide e-commerce platforms due to the danger of counterfeit products.
3. Can tourists buy weight reduction products over the counter in Italy?
Yes. Travelers can quickly purchase basic dietary supplements, natural items, and OTC medical gadgets (dispositivi medici) at any regional farmacia or parafarmacia without requiring a local healthcare ID.
4. Are American weight loss supplements legal to import into Italy?
Numerous popular American supplements contain components or does that are classified in a different way or restricted under European Union food safety laws. It is suggested to inspect EU guidelines before attempting to ship foreign supplements into Italy.
5. What is the Italian equivalent of a natural food store?
The Italian equivalent is an Erboristeria (herbalist store) or specialized natural stores called Negozi Biologici (or "Bio" shops), which bring natural wellness items, organic supplements, and organic teas.
